Yesterday I spent the afternoon sorting through boxes of archived files, –class notes from college and grad school, articles on business that I had saved for a second reading that never happened, and family related materials. It was an archeological dig into the past of selves that became the person that I now am. I felt waves of emotion.

Here are some old quotations that are worth considering again at the age of 69.

If one could measure change in American society up to 1900, it would come to three inches: basically an agricultural society. From 1900 to 1950, it would be 3 feet. From 1950 to now, it would be as high as the Washington monument.
–unattributed

The end is not an ungrounded presupposition. It is an ungrounded way of acting.
—Wittgenstein, from On Certainty

The language game is to say something unpredictable. It is not based on grounds. It is not reasonable or unreasonable. It is there—like our life.
—Wittgenstein, from On Certainty

Without constant reference to sensation by which mental expectations are affirmed or denied such a complete identification of images with things occurs that all criticism of the former is rendered impossible and all response to the latter is channeled into customary ways.
—Michael Polanyi from Personal Knowledge

There are two kinds of people…..those who are really alive and those who are merely living. Those merely living are usually well-fed, well-liked, well-bred, and well-meaning. The painless and the pleasurable is their style of life, and much of the time we enjoy being around them. They make no demands on us. Their conversation is never disturbing. The graciousness of their lives is supportive and affirming. More often than not we covet the relaxed existence they lead. But in reflective moments we know that they are straw people who fear change and reject the future, for who mediocrity is an accomplishment and blandness a rainbow. To their existence there is no excitement, only thrills, there is no action, only motion, there is no intensity, only duration. They are safe because they are not alive to anything innovative, daring or exploratory.

Do something!
—Jim Boyd
